<p>Online portfolio of Photographer Lisa Pram.</p>
<p> About the interface: It is a  specific design approach to online image galleries aiming to produce an integrated graphical product based on the work itself. The result of this search is an &#8220;interactive barcode&#8221;, generating a unique representation of  Lisa Pram’s work in a non-metaphorical manner,  through indexing of her image sets according to four main keywords, which stand for the main areas of her work &#8211; Professional, Experimental , Advertising and Editorial. Clicking on each of them allows the visitor to filter through her image galleries.  Each gallery is represented by a line which thickness reflects the number of images it contains &#8211; 1 image is 1 pixel width. This simple principle leads to the barcode representation. Clicking each of these lines unfolds its pictures in a continuous strip inside the barcode, thus introducing the user into the colors and contrasts of her work.</p>
